Proportion of forest area within legally established protected areas in Sudan
Sudan: Proportion of forest area within legally established protected areas was 11.4% in 2025. ▲ Rising
Proportion of forest area within legally established protected areas in Sudan, 1990–2025
Source: United Nations Statistics Division, SDG Global Database.
Analysis
Sudan recorded 11.4% for proportion of forest area within legally established protected areas in 2025. That is the highest value across all 6 years on record.
Compared with earlier readings it is unchanged over ten years.
Over the whole period, proportion of forest area within legally established protected areas in Sudan peaked at 11.4% in 2010 and was at its lowest, 9.5%, in 1990.
Sudan ranks 108th of 168 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
